Rudbeckia hirta var. hirta
Distribution
Native to:
Alabama, Arkansas, Connecticut, Delaware, Georgia, Illinois, Indiana, Kentucky, Maine, Maryland, Massachusetts, Michigan, Mississippi, New Hampshire, New Jersey, New York, North Carolina, Ohio, Pennsylvania, South Carolina, Tennessee, Vermont, Virginia, West Virginia
Introduced into:
Austria, Baltic States, Belarus, Belgium, Cuba, Czechoslovakia, France, Germany, Great Britain, Hungary, Ireland, Irkutsk, Italy, Kazakhstan, Kirgizstan, Krym, Kuril Is., Myanmar, Netherlands, Norway, Poland, Primorye, Romania, South European Russi, Spain, Switzerland, Turkmenistan, Ukraine, Uzbekistan, West Siberia, Yugoslavia
